Dr. Deryl Lamb is an Arizona native who graduated from Cornell University and the University of Arizona College of Medicine in 1991. He completed a family practice residency at Good Samaritan (now Banner University) in Phoenix and started a solo practice in Queen Creek, AZ, in 1996. After more than 20 years in the insurance‑based, fee‑for‑service model, Dr. Lamb transitioned to the direct primary care movement in 2018. He is passionate about a whole‑food, plant‑based lifestyle and advocates its health benefits. Dr. Lamb has served as a Primary Care Physician in the East Valley for over two decades and has delivered over 1,200 babies.
